Harnessing SAP ECC for New Product Development: A Deep Dive into Methods and Tools
Table of Contents
- Introduction
- SAP ECC: A Foundation for NPD
- NPD Lifecycle in SAP ECC: Methods and Tools
- 3.1 Idea Generation and Concept Development
- 3.2 Feasibility Study and Cost Analysis
- 3.3 Design and Development
- 3.4 Prototype Development and Testing
- 3.5 Production Planning and Execution
- 3.6 Product Launch and Commercialization
- 3.7 Post-Launch Review and Continuous Improvement
- Integration with Other SAP Modules
- Extending SAP ECC for NPD
- Integration with SAP Business Technology Platform (BTP)
- Conclusion
1. Introduction
In the dynamic landscape of product innovation, businesses need robust systems to manage the complexities of New Product Development (NPD). SAP ECC (Enterprise Central Component), while succeeded by S/4HANA, remains a powerful ERP solution with a rich set of functionalities to support NPD processes. This article delves into the methods and tools available within SAP ECC, providing a comprehensive guide for organizations to leverage this platform for efficient product development.
2. SAP ECC: A Foundation for NPD
SAP ECC offers a modular architecture with integrated functionalities that cover various aspects of the NPD lifecycle. From initial ideation to post-launch analysis, ECC provides tools to streamline processes, manage resources, and track progress. Its core modules, including Materials Management (MM), Production Planning (PP), Sales and Distribution (SD), and Controlling (CO), play a crucial role in supporting NPD initiatives.
3. NPD Lifecycle in SAP ECC: Methods and Tools
Let's explore how SAP ECC facilitates each phase of the NPD process:
3.1 Idea Generation and Concept Development
- Methods:
- Material Master Data Management: Create new material masters (MM01) to represent initial product concepts. Utilize material types (e.g., raw materials, semi-finished goods) for classification.
- Classification System: Assign characteristics and classes to materials (CL02, CL20N) for efficient categorization and retrieval of product ideas.
- Document Management System (DMS): Store and manage technical documents, sketches, and design ideas (CV01N, CV04N) in a centralized repository.
3.2 Feasibility Study and Cost Analysis
- Methods:
- Product Cost Planning (CO-PC): Estimate costs (CK11N) for materials, labor, and overhead. Simulate costs for different design and production scenarios.
- Profitability Analysis (CO-PA): Assess potential profitability (KE30) of the new product based on cost estimates and projected sales.
- Variant Configuration: Analyze cost implications (CU50, PMEVC) for different product variants based on customer requirements.
3.3 Design and Development
- Methods:
- Bill of Materials (BOM) Creation: Develop structured BOMs (CS01) that define the components and sub-assemblies required for the product.
- Routing and Work Centers: Define production processes using routings (CA01) and assign work centers (CR01) to represent production resources.
- Integrated Engineering Change Management (ECM): Manage design changes (CC01, CC02) with change masters to ensure traceability and version control.
3.4 Prototype Development and Testing
- Methods:
- Production Order Management: Create production orders (CO01) to manufacture prototypes for testing and validation.
- Quality Management (QM): Perform inspections and quality checks (QA01) during the prototyping phase to ensure adherence to standards.
- Batch Management: Track and trace prototype batches (MSC1N) for effective management and analysis.
3.5 Production Planning and Execution
- Methods:
- Material Requirements Planning (MRP): Plan material availability and procurement (MD01, MD02) to support production schedules.
- Capacity Planning: Optimize resource utilization (CM01, CM25) by analyzing capacity requirements and constraints.
- Shop Floor Control: Monitor production progress (CO11N) and manage shop floor activities in real-time.
3.6 Product Launch and Commercialization
- Methods:
- Sales and Distribution (SD): Create sales orders (VA01) and manage delivery and billing processes for the new product.
- Pricing Procedures: Define pricing strategies (VK11) based on cost analysis, market conditions, and desired profit margins.
- Integration with CRM: Leverage CRM functionalities to manage product marketing campaigns and gather customer feedback.
3.7 Post-Launch Review and Continuous Improvement
- Methods:
- Actual Costing and Profitability Reporting: Analyze actual costs against planned costs (CO-PC, CO-PA) to identify variances and areas for improvement.
- Warranty and Service Management: Track warranty claims and manage service orders (IW31) to address customer issues and improve product quality.
- Analytics and Reporting: Generate reports (using SAP Query, Report Painter) on sales, costs, and profitability to gain insights into product performance.
4. Integration with Other SAP Modules
- SAP Project System (PS): Manage complex NPD projects with work breakdown structures (WBS) and network activities for better planning and control.
- SAP Supplier Relationship Management (SRM): Collaborate with vendors for material sourcing and procurement, ensuring timely delivery and cost-effectiveness.
- SAP Human Capital Management (HCM): Allocate skilled resources to NPD projects based on expertise and availability, optimizing workforce utilization.
5. Extending SAP ECC for NPD
- ABAP Development: Utilize ABAP programming language for custom development to meet specific NPD requirements not covered by standard functionalities.
- Business Add-Ins (BAdIs): Implement custom business logic and extensions to enhance existing SAP processes without modifying the core code.
- Customer Exits: Customize standard SAP functionality by adding user-defined code at predefined points within the system.
- Table Enhancements: Extend standard SAP tables with custom fields to capture additional data relevant to NPD processes.
6. Integration with SAP Business Technology Platform (BTP)
- Low/No-Code Development: Leverage tools like SAP Build Apps and Process Automation to create custom applications and automate workflows for NPD.
- Pro-Code Development: Utilize Business Application Studio and ABAP Environment for advanced development and integration with SAP ECC.
- Integration Services: Connect SAP ECC with external systems using SAP Integration Suite (formerly SAP Cloud Platform Integration) for seamless data exchange.
7. Conclusion
SAP ECC provides a comprehensive toolkit for managing the entire NPD lifecycle. By effectively utilizing its functionalities, organizations can streamline their processes, control costs, and accelerate time-to-market. While SAP S/4HANA represents the future of SAP ERP, ECC remains a valuable asset for businesses seeking to optimize their product development initiatives.
No comments:
Post a Comment